"Server Manager -> Configuration -> Local Users and Groups" is not available in Windows Server 2008 R2

22,619

Since this is a domain controller, you don't have local users and groups.

Other than the Directory Services Restore Mode account, there are no "local" accounts on a domain controller. Only domain accounts.
